猿代码 — 科研/AI模型/高性能计算
0

"HPC环境下GPU加速并行计算优化实践"

摘要: 在HPC环境下,GPU加速并行计算是一种常见的优化实践。随着计算需求的不断增长,越来越多的研究者和工程师开始利用GPU来提高计算性能和效率。GPU加速并行计算可以充分利用GPU的大规模并行处理能力,加快计算速度。在H ...
在HPC环境下,GPU加速并行计算是一种常见的优化实践。随着计算需求的不断增长,越来越多的研究者和工程师开始利用GPU来提高计算性能和效率。

GPU加速并行计算可以充分利用GPU的大规模并行处理能力,加快计算速度。在HPC领域,GPU通常被用于加速科学仿真、深度学习、图像处理等计算密集型任务。相较于传统的CPU计算,GPU具有更多的核心数以及更高的内存带宽,因此可以更有效地处理大规模数据和复杂计算任务。

为了实现GPU加速并行计算的优化实践,首先需要选择合适的GPU硬件。当前市面上有多种不同型号的GPU可以选择,如NVIDIA的Tesla系列、AMD的Radeon系列等。在选择GPU时,需要考虑计算需求、预算以及与现有系统的兼容性。

除了选择合适的硬件外,还需要优化并行计算的算法和代码。通过合理设计并行计算程序的数据结构、算法逻辑以及优化编译选项,可以最大程度地发挥GPU的性能优势。此外,还可以利用并行计算框架如CUDA、OpenCL等来简化并行程序的开发和调试过程。

另外,合理的任务划分和负载均衡也是GPU加速并行计算优化的关键。在将计算任务划分为多个并行子任务时,需要考虑各个子任务之间的通信和数据依赖关系,避免出现负载不均衡或通信开销过大的情况。

总的来说,GPU加速并行计算是HPC领域的一个重要优化实践,可以显著提高计算效率和性能。通过选择合适的GPU硬件、优化算法和代码以及合理的任务划分和负载均衡,可以实现更快速、更高效的并行计算。希望未来能有更多的研究者和工程师深入研究和应用GPU加速并行计算技术,为科学研究和工程领域的发展贡献力量。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-20 16:32
  • 0
    粉丝
  • 505
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)